NH4+ is the ammonium radical, which consists of one nitrogen and four hydrogen atoms in an ionized state. It is a compound radical because it has more than one atom. An ion that consists of just one atom, such as Na+ is not a compound.

Ammonium phosphate is the name for the compound (NH4)3PO4. It is a white crystalline salt that is commonly used as a fertilizer.
NH4+ is inorganic because it does not contain carbon-hydrogen bonds that are characteristic of organic compounds. NH4+ is the ammonium ion, which is composed of nitrogen and hydrogen atoms.
